Mastering Modern Emission Control Systems
Modern emissions standards have introduced sophisticated components like Diesel Particulate Filters (DPF) and Selective Catalytic Reduction (SCR) systems. These are common failure points that often trigger “limp mode,” effectively paralyzing your truck. We meticulously check Exhaust Gas Recirculation (EGR) flow and sensor accuracy to keep your vehicle compliant with Utah County standards. Since 2026 is an even-numbered year, even-model-year vehicles in Utah County must pass emissions tests. Proper diagnostics ensure you aren’t hit with unexpected registration delays or the new “High Emissions Heavy Duty Vehicle” fees for older rigs over 14,000 lbs.
Fuel System and Turbocharger Analysis
High-pressure common rail (HPCR) systems operate under immense stress. Even a microscopic amount of contamination can lead to catastrophic failure. We monitor turbocharger health through boost pressure testing and detailed oil analysis to catch wear before it leads to a roadside breakdown. Precise fuel delivery is the foundation of diesel efficiency and longevity. The 2026 Diesel Maintenance Protocol
In 2026, maintenance is more than just oil changes. We monitor coolant PH levels to prevent liner pitting and check belt tension to avoid cooling system failures. A critical focus area is the air intake system. Even a small leak can “dust” an engine, leading to catastrophic internal damage in a matter of hours. We also utilize specific inspection protocols for your DPF and EGR systems. With the 2026 Utah County emissions requirements in full effect for even-numbered model years, keeping these systems clean is vital to avoiding “limp mode” and expensive compliance fees.

How does the Utah climate affect diesel engine performance in 2026?
Utah’s high altitude and extreme temperature fluctuations place additional stress on cooling systems and turbochargers. Cold starts in winter can thicken oil and strain batteries, while summer heat tests the limits of your radiator. In 2026, even-model-year vehicles must also meet specific Utah County emissions standards. We adjust our preventive maintenance protocols to account for these regional stressors, ensuring your engine remains efficient regardless of the weather.
What should I do if my diesel truck enters “limp mode”?
If your truck enters “limp mode,” you should pull over safely and schedule professional diagnostics immediately. This reduced-power state is a protective measure triggered by the ECM to prevent engine damage, often due to emission system or sensor failures. Continuing to drive in this state can lead to expensive rework or catastrophic failure.
